It’s official. We’ve found the cutest things ever. Earlier this week, researchers named three new salamanders as the smallest four-legged creatures known to science. They can easily fit on a dime, and that’s […]
from Geek.com http://ift.tt/2fZ5qc7
via IFTTT






0 comments:
Post a Comment